Busy day for bombers.

298.40:  SPACE-1, (C-21A, Peterson), takeoff Colorado Springs. Return later 
as JOSA-583.
275.80:  REDEYE-11, (F-16, Buckley), cleared to Albuquerque.
377.05:  ?BATT-71?, flight of 2, (?B-2A, Whiteman?), with Denver Center, in 
the Block 340 - 350; RVSM compliant.  Switch 380.15. ((Kept cutting off the 
callsign and all I could get was the "1" in the suffix, but a BATT-71 flight did 
come back thru later going in the opposite direction. What was strange, was 
them reporting "RVSM compliant." Before, have always heard "non-RVSM" from all 
military aircraft.))
251.25:  TACO-21, flight of 2, (F-16, NM-ANG), working in Airburst Range.
349.20:  TIGER-91, (Possible F-16, Shaw), request WX Tinker.
354.15:  TIGER-91, (?F-16, Shaw?), with Denver Center, FL 450. ((Or could be 
F-15 out of Mountain Home))
298.40:  JOSA-946, (C-21A), takeoff Colorado Springs.
370.10:  THUNDER-41, flight of 2, (B-1B, Ellsworth), with Denver Center. 
372.20:  JOSA-068, (C-21A, Peterson), takeoff Colorado Springs. Return later.
291.675: REDEYE-21, (F-16, Buckley), land.
298.40:  BATT-71, flight of 2, (B-2A, Whiteman), with High Country Control.
Needs pp to MADDOG at Whiteman. Reports RTB. Has 1 hung inert JDAM and 3 
retained inert JDAMs along with 1 retained BDU-56. Is bringing BATT-73 back 
with him, as 73 also has 1 retained inert JDAM. BATT-72 is clean and is 
pressing on with the mission. Will return separately.
276.40:  BATT-71, flight of 2, (B-2A, Whiteman), with Denver Center, Block 
410 - 430.
Switch 353.65 and 360.65. 
239.025: VEGAS-31, flight of 4, (Unk type, Nellis), land Colorado Springs.
 360.65:  DEATH-72, (B-2A, Whiteman), with Denver Center.
350.30:  LOMA-11, (F-16, OH-ANG), with Denver Center, FL 350, non-RVSM. 
Switch 316.125.
372.20:  JOSA-068, (C-21A, Peterson), land Colorado Springs, then off again 
for St Louis. Returned for the final time around 2040 MST.
263.00:  BATT-72, (B-2A, Whiteman), with Denver Center, FL 370.
